| Genotype: | MATa/MATalpha deltatpi::LEU2/deltatpi::LEU2 leu2/leu2 +/his4 pep4-3/pep4-3 cir+ |
| Preceptrol®: | no |
| Comments: | Recombinant expression of alpha-1-antitrypsin
Recombinant expression of proteinase A
Saccharomyces cerevisiae E18 (TS196117) reverted and has been redeposited as ATCC 20893. |
| Morphology: | On YEP-galactose medium at 30°C after 5 days, colonies are butyrous and light cream colored. Cells are globose, ovoid or elongated and are usually isolated or in small groups. |
| Medium: | ATCC® Medium 1393: YEP-galactose |
| Growth Conditions: | Temperature: 30°C
Atmosphere: Typical aerobic |
